]> git.plutz.net Git - serve0/blobdiff - advsearch.sh
Merge commit 'b931bbd0c30907b9cc956d3707b26b449bf41f76'
[serve0] / advsearch.sh
old mode 100644 (file)
new mode 100755 (executable)
index 1054618..24d31c9
@@ -3,7 +3,7 @@
 f=''
 order="$(POST order |grep -m1 -xE 'Name|Date|Length|Group' || printf Name)"
 
-for n in 1 2 3 4 5 6 7 8 9; do
+for n in 1 2 3 4 5 6 7 8 9 10; do
   [ "$(POST pol_$n)" = neg ] \
   && f="$f~"
   cat="$(POST cat_$n)"
@@ -15,7 +15,7 @@ for n in 1 2 3 4 5 6 7 8 9; do
   done
   f="${f%[|^]}^"
 done
-f="$(printf '%s' "$f" |sed -E 's;[~|^]+$;;')"
+f="$(printf '%s' "$f" |sed -E 's;[~|^]+$;;; s;\|\^;^;g;')"
 #f="${f%^}"
 
 REDIRECT "$(URL "${ITEM}")?o=${order}&f=${f}"